In this episode of Everyday Medicine, host Dr. Christopher Chiu speaks with Dr. Dan Jonas, the Division Director of General Internal Medicine at Ohio State University, about screening for alcohol use disorder. The discussion covers the prevalence and impact of unhealthy alcohol use in the U.S., the importance of screening in primary care, and effective screening tools like the single alcohol screening question and the AUDIT-C. They also delve into the STUN (Stop Unhealthy Alcohol Use Now) trials, which explore strategies to improve the implementation of screening and brief counseling for alcohol use in primary care settings. Dr. Jonas emphasizes the significant benefits of these interventions and offers practical advice for integrating screening into routine patient visits.
